In Madurai district, Tamil Nadu, 3,596 individuals across 10 Assembly constituencies will have the opportunity to cast their votes from home during the upcoming elections for the Tamil Nadu Legislative Assembly. This initiative, announced by District Election Officer K.J. Praveen Kumar, is specifically designed for persons with disabilities and those aged 85 years and older, who may face challenges in traveling to polling stations. The general public will vote on April 23, 2026, while this home voting option aims to ensure that vulnerable populations can participate in the democratic process without difficulty. The Election Commission of India has established these guidelines to promote inclusivity in the electoral system.
